关于asp.net mvc开发,我有一些简单的问题。

UpdateModel和TryUpdateModel的用途是什么?以及哪些条件适用于使用UpdateModel或TryUpdateModel。根据我的经验,除了将FormCollection绑定到Model之外,TryUpdateModel还可以验证数据。这是正确的吗 ?

最佳答案

没错,这两种方法都可以用Form值更新Model并执行验证。有一个默认的活页夹,但是如果需要,您可以构建自定义的活页夹。

两种方法之间的区别在于,如果验证失败,则UpdateModel将引发异常,而TryUpdateModel将以布尔值通知有关验证结果。

关于asp.net-mvc - UpdateModel与TryUpdateModel,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/636703/

10-11 01:35